To borrow a phrase, “Oh my nerves” … the team (except for Warren Zackey) are having a torrid time out there. “Card dead … didn't play a hand in 10 rotations … short stacked … ” these were the key phrases heard during the last break of the evening. Warren is sitting very comfortably with 498,000; while Ryan Brauer has 115,000; Kinesh Pather – 76,000; Ronit Chamani – 50,000; Mel Banfield – 51,000 and Ryan Dreyer – 42,300. It was confirmed that Ray Rahme went out just before the dinner break.
But despite these tough, grinding hours – they pumped each other up, offered words of encouragement and headed back heads held high into the tournament room.
With 930 players remaining (282 players away from the cash!) on blinds of 1500/3000 and a 400 ante, it really is crunch time for the team at the World Series of Poker.
